Destin traces its immediate history to a fisherman, Leonard Destin, who moved here from New London, Connecticut, and settled in Northwest Florida around 1845. For decades, he and his descendants fished and navigated the only channel passage to the Gulf of Mexico between Panama City and Pensacola, known as Destin’s East Pass.
Stunning white beaches, challenging golf and world-famous fishing define the Emerald Coast city of Destin. Snuggled against the Gulf of Mexico in northwest Florida, Destin is rightfully famed for its sugar-white sands and emerald-hued waters. And due to its plentiful and always hungry underwater population, Destin is widely known as the "world’s luckiest fishing village." The most wonderful months of the year in Destin are April and May when the water is warm, the sun is shining and the temperatures are comfortable. The first months of the year the weather is cooler and the water chilly. In late summer and early fall, the temperatures can be sweltering and accompanied by rain. Average highs reach the high 80s in summer, while winter temps fluctuate between the low 40s and 60s.
